Manav Suthar Wants to Learn From Ravindra Jadeja After Galle Debut
India debutant Manav Suthar said he wants to learn from experienced spinner Ravindra Jadeja after taking four wickets against Sri Lanka in the first Test at Galle.
Suthar claimed 4-76 in 21.4 overs as India bowled Sri Lanka out for 284 and secured a 178-run first-innings lead. Jadeja took 3-67 and reached the milestone of 350 Test wickets as the left-arm spin duo shared seven wickets. Suthar praised Jadeja’s consistency and stump-to-stump bowling, highlighting his ability to use the bowling crease effectively. The youngster also studied Sri Lanka’s spinners and noted the importance of varying pace and maintaining consistency on the Galle surface.
Suthar, who was playing his first Test, said taking a wicket with his opening delivery gave him significant confidence.
